Can you deep fry fish in olive oil?

Can Fish Be Fried in Olive Oil? If you plan to fry fish in olive oil, it’s perfectly healthy to do so. However, it has a lower smoke point so it’s harder to keep it at the proper temperature. It will also impart a slight olive flavor to the fish, which isn’t necessarily a bad thing.

Does olive oil become carcinogenic when heated?

Myth: Olive oil produces carcinogens when it’s heated. Fact. What’s true is that when any cooking oil is heated to the point where it smokes (its smoke point) it breaks down and may produce potentially carcinogenic toxins. Different oils reach their smoke points at different temperatures.

Which oils should not be heated?

Unrefined oils such as flaxseed oil, wheat germ oil, and walnut oil have a low smoke point and should not be heated.
